    What a great video! Very well done.. What I'm struggling to wrap my brain around is why Honda does not optimize the ECU mapping if it's really not detrimental to the engine. How could such a large gain be had just by tuning the ECU of a machine that is designed for performance? Honda should know every single parameter that the motor can operate safely in and could easily optimize the ECU to reach those specs so why don't they?

    • @ejgrae1989
      @ejgrae1989 10 หลายเดือนก่อน

      Seems to me a few things. Emissions and longevity/reliability. They have recommended a very hands off maintenance schedule of 8k miles I think between oil changes and the bike seems to be set up for happy dual sporting aimed at the entry market in terms of price and setup of the bike itself. You run a bike a bit richer for more torque and a bit more ignition advance this does inevitably increase cylinder wear as you get a bit more washing of oil off the cylinder wall with rich mixture and a bit more heat from ignition advance and this also degrades the oil faster as does running it hard which you’re more tempted to do if the bike has more power most people use whatever power the bike has most of the time. I think if you tune a bike you need to up the maintenance schedule significantly.

    Did I miss the Dyno test results ?

    • @patoneill555
      @patoneill555  ปีที่แล้ว

      I was able to get a chart from Maverick. Stock - 23.51hp Peak. 550 Stage 1 - 27.87hp Peak.

    ¿Your CRF300L has the infamous 5K rattle ?

    • @patoneill555
      @patoneill555  ปีที่แล้ว +1

      It did!

    • @josepfrancesc8776
      @josepfrancesc8776 ปีที่แล้ว +1

      ¿So how did you find the solution?

    • @patoneill555
      @patoneill555  ปีที่แล้ว +4

      @Josep Francesc the 550 ECU eliminates the rattle. The rattle is caused by Piston slap, and the new ignition timing has remedied this.

  • @shmack-dab-in-da-middle3960
    @shmack-dab-in-da-middle3960 10 หลายเดือนก่อน

    You don't need all those airbox. Mods, all you need is a d n a air filter and it runs perfect with it with full yoshi

    • @patoneill555
      @patoneill555  10 หลายเดือนก่อน +1

      Unfortunately, the DNA filter is a K&N style filter. Great for road riding. However, once you get serious in the dirt, they tend to get clogged up much faster than a proper foam filter. Hence, why performance off-road bikes run the foam style direct from the factory.
